The present invention provides anti-TIM-3 antibodies, methods for generating hybridomas, nucleic acid molecules encoding anti-TIM-3 antibodies, expression vectors and host cells used for the expression of anti-TIM-3 antibodies. The present invention further provides a method for verifying the function of the antibody in vitro and the efficacy of the antibody in vivo. The antibody of the present invention provides a very potent agent for cancer treatment by modulating immune function. |
